Aktepe, Vedat – Educational Sciences: Theory and Practice, 2015
The purpose of this study is to determine the effects of the love of nature performance task on the opinions and attitudes of 4th grade primary school students at the Science and Art center towards their value of love of nature. Kirikkaya, Esma Bulus; Vurkaya, Gurbet – Educational Sciences: Theory and Practice, 2011
The pre-test and post-test quasi-experimental design with control group was used in this study, in which the impact of alternative assessment activities on students' academic achievement levels and attitudes were explored by employing these activities in the unit "Electricity in Our Lives" of the Science and Technology Course. Dilmac, Bulent; Kulaksizoglu, Adnan; Eksi, Halil – Educational Sciences: Theory and Practice, 2007
The purpose of this study is to find out whether the humane values education program has produced any changes on the students' level of humane values.
